Magnetic properties of the Nd1-xGdxCo4Si compounds
Polycrystalline series of single phase Nd1-xGdxCo4Si (0 <= x <= 1) solid solutions were prepared and characterized by X-ray powder diffraction (XRPD) and magnetization measurements. The powder X-ray diffraction patterns show that all samples crystallize as a single phase having the hexagonal CaCu5-type structure. The substitution of Gd for Nd leads to a decrease of the unit cell parameters a and c, and the unit cell volume V. Magnetic measurements indicate that all samples are ordered magnetically below the Curie temperature. The saturation magnetization at 4.2 K decreases upon the Gd substitution up to x = 0.6, and then increases. (C) 2009 Elsevier B.V. All rights reserved.
